The National Department of Agriculture has a total budget of about R187 million, with a significant portion of it, about 42%, going towards immunomodulating drugs, which is about R78 million. They also spend a substantial amount on hotels and lodging, fuels, travel facilitation, and banking services. Their top suppliers include Onderstepoort Biological Product, FNB Fleet Services, and Tourvest Travel Services, indicating a favour towards local organisations. The department's spending has remained steady, with no year-on-year growth, which might indicate a stable procurement programme.
